The Thing About Pam - NBC/Blumhouse Renee Zellweger Dark Comedy
Posted on 3/11/22 at 8:58 am
Posted on 3/11/22 at 8:58 am
Yeah, I get it that it's based on a real woman's murder. There was a whole Dateline episode about it, etc., but I wasn't interested in watching this until Mrs. Vox caught the first episode and said they had Keith Morrison narrating it, and the approach is very tongue-in-cheek.
A rural Missouri housewife with cancer turns up dead in what is assumed to be a textbook case of The Husband Obviously Did It. The problem is that Renee Zellweger (under a ton of makeup) is her meddling, narcissist best frenemy who can't go to the convenience store without it looking suspicious.
